Preheat oven to 350°F. In a large bowl, using a hand mixer, mix cream cheese, mayonnaise, sour cream, Old Bay Seasoning, Hot sauce, and ground mustard until combined well. Add crabmeat and stir gently to fold it all in. Spread in a shallow 1 1/2-quart baking dish. Sprinkle with Cheddar cheese.

Preheat oven to 425 degrees Fahrenheit. In a large bowl, whisk together the softened cream cheese, sour cream, and mayonnaise until smooth. Whisk in the spices, sauces, and lemon juice. Stir in the crab meat, Parmesan cheese, green onions, and 1/2 cup of the grated Monterey Jack cheese.

Instructions.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Add cream cheese to a mixing bowl and beat until smooth. Stir in mayo, sour cream, garlic, green onion, Old Bay seasoning, salt, Worcestershire, and lemon juice. Add ¾ cup cheddar cheese and hot sauce and mix until smooth. Stir in crab meat.

Crab Dip 101 How do I serve this crab dip warm? To serve this crab dip warm, preheat the oven to 350ºF and place the crab dip into a small cassoulet or other oven safe dish. Bake the crab dip for 15-20 minutes. Top with 1/2 cup of mozzarella cheese and turn the oven to broil. Broil until the mozzarella is bubbly and golden brown.

Spread the Warmth. When serving warm crab dip to your guests, surround it with toasted bread-based accompaniments such as baguette slices. Sturdy crackers, breadsticks or pita chips also work well. The important thing is to provide enough support for the warm dip, since it would be otherwise awkward to handle it with your fingers.

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(177 degrees C). In a large bowl, stir together the cream cheese, sour cream, mayonnaise, lemon juice, and Old Bay seasoning, until smooth and creamy. Stir in the cheddar cheese, chives, and hot sauce, to taste. Adjust Old Bay seasoning to taste if needed.

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. Add cream cheese to a mixing bowl and beat with a handheld mixer on medium-high speed for one minute. Add sour cream, mayonnaise, Worcestershire, lemon juice and all seasonings and beat until combined. Stir in green onions, ½ cup cheddar, ½ cup mozzarella, then fold in crab meat.
